Obergurgl 2026: Must-Know Tips Before You Go

Planning a trip to Obergurgl in 2026? This charming Austrian village, nestled high in the Ötztal Alps, offers an unforgettable mountain experience, but a little preparation goes a long way. Ensure you book accommodation well in advance, especially if you're traveling during peak ski season, which typically runs from December to April. Obergurgl is renowned for its high-altitude skiing, boasting excellent snow reliability throughout the season. When it comes to transport, flying into Innsbruck Airport (INN) is the most convenient option, followed by a scenic transfer, often by bus or pre-booked shuttle. Consider the travel time from Innsbruck, which can be around 1.5 to 2 hours. For those interested in activities beyond skiing, Obergurgl offers fantastic opportunities for winter hiking and snowshoeing, with well-maintained trails available. Remember to pack layers of warm clothing, including waterproof outerwear, a hat, gloves, and sturdy, waterproof footwear. Don't forget sun protection; the sun at high altitudes can be surprisingly strong, even on cloudy days. Finally, familiarize yourself with the local currency, the Euro, and be aware that while many establishments accept cards, carrying some cash is advisable for smaller purchases or in more remote areas.

Let's talk food! Indulge in hearty Tyrolean cuisine. Think creamy Käsespätzle (cheese noodles), flavorful Wiener Schnitzel (breaded veal cutlet), and delicious Apfelstrudel (apple strudel) for dessert. You'll find plenty of welcoming restaurants offering both traditional Austrian fare and international options. A typical restaurant meal for two might cost around €60-€80.

Regarding transportation, a multi-day ski pass will cost approximately €200-€300 per person, depending on the duration. Getting around the resort is easy, with regular shuttle services available. Accommodation costs vary greatly, depending on the type of lodging you choose, from cozy guesthouses to luxurious hotels. Expect to pay anywhere from €80 to €300 per night for a double room.

Beyond skiing, you can enjoy snowshoeing, ice skating, or simply relaxing in a thermal spa. The weather during ski season is typically cold and snowy, with average temperatures ranging from -5°C to 5°C (23°F to 41°F). Don't forget your warm layers!

Local traditions are rich and vibrant. Look out for traditional Christmas markets (if your trip aligns) and the general friendly atmosphere. You're likely to see people wearing traditional Tracht (dirndl for women and lederhosen for men), especially during festive occasions.

Let's estimate the total cost for a 5-day/4-night trip for two people: Accommodation (€160-€600), Ski Passes (€400-€600), Food & Drinks (€300-€400), Activities (€100-€200) – This brings the total estimated cost to somewhere between €960 and €1800 for the entire trip. This is a rough estimate, and prices can vary depending on your choices.

Obergurgl: Essential Knowledge Before Your Austrian Alps Adventure

Before embarking on your adventure to Obergurgl, it's essential to grasp a few key aspects to ensure a seamless and enjoyable experience. This charming Austrian village, nestled high in the Ötztal Alps, is renowned for its exceptional skiing and snowboarding opportunities, making it a prime destination for winter sports enthusiasts. When planning your trip, consider that Obergurgl is a high-altitude resort, meaning conditions can be colder and snow is generally plentiful from late November through to late April. Booking accommodation and ski passes in advance is highly recommended, especially during peak season, to secure your preferred options and potentially benefit from early bird discounts. Familiarize yourself with the lift system and the extensive piste network; Obergurgl is known for its well-groomed slopes suitable for all skill levels, from beginners to advanced skiers. Don't forget to pack appropriate clothing, including thermal layers, waterproof outerwear, and good quality gloves and a hat, as the weather can change rapidly in the mountains. Check the avalanche forecast regularly if you plan on venturing off-piste. For those not skiing, Obergurgl offers stunning winter hiking trails and snowshoeing routes, providing alternative ways to appreciate the breathtaking alpine scenery. Consider purchasing travel insurance that covers winter sports and potential medical emergencies, as alpine environments can present inherent risks. Finally, be prepared for the quieter, more relaxed atmosphere that Obergurgl offers, a stark contrast to some of the livelier party resorts, making it ideal for families and those seeking tranquility amidst magnificent natural beauty.
